I work in the Liam McAllister group. We study compactifications of string theory on Calabi-Yau threefolds using the software CYTools. This software boils down to efficient algorithms on regular triangulations of reflexive polytopes and optimization in high-dimensional polyhedral fans. I develop/maintain this software.
